Mental Health in Veterans and Families After Group Therapies
April 15, 2024 updated by: Dawson Church, Soul Medicine Institute
PTSD (posttraumatic stress disorder) and associated mental health conditions affect both veterans and their family members.
This study investigates whether group therapy using EFT (Emotional Freedom Techniques) and CBT (Cognitive Behavior Therapy) produce reductions in PTSD and comorbid symptoms.
